Animal models of tinnitus.

Carol A Bauer1.   

Abstract

Tinnitus is a complex phenomenon that is poorly understood. A significant tool for studying the pathophysiology of tinnitus and exploring potential treatments is an animal model. This article discusses the general techniques for evaluating psychophysical phenomenon in nonhuman subjects. An overview of a model of chronic tinnitus in rats and chinchillas is presented.
